07.09.2011 09:43 Il y a : 253 jour(s)
Soutenance publique de Thèse le Vendredi 23 septembre 2011 à 10 h
Categorie : Manifestation, Recherche
par M. Youssef RIDENE , pour obtenir le grade de Docteur en informatique
Soutenance publique de Thèse le Vendredi 23 septembre 2011 à 10 h
par M. Youssef RIDENE
pour obtenir le grade de Docteur en Informatique de l'Université de Pau et des Pays de l'Adour
Lieu : Estia 2
Sujet : Ingénierie dirigée par les modèles pour la gestion de la variabilité dans le test d’application mobile
Examinateurs
M. Franck BARBIER, Professeur, Université de Pau et des Pays de l'Adour (Co-directeur de thèse)
M. Benoit BAUDRY, Chargé de recherche (HDR) à l'INRIA de Rennes (Rapporteur)
M. Xavier BLANC, Professeur, Université Bordeaux 1 (Examinateur)
M. Fabrice BOUQUET, Professeur, Université de Franche-Comté (Rapporteur)
Mme. Nadine COUTURE, Enseignant-Chercheur (HDR), ESTIA-RECHERCHE (Co-directeur de thèse)
Invité
Résumé
Les applications embarquées sur téléphones mobiles sont de plus en plus riches et diversifiées; elles suscitent l'engouement du grand public en même temps que son exigence quant à leur qualité. Seule une procédure prouvée et rigoureuse de test des logiciels permet de satisfaire ces exigences; or le test est une tâche répétitive, fastidieuse et coûteuse, principalement à cause du nombre important de modèles de terminaux mobiles, très différents les uns des autres.
Dans cette thèse, nous proposons le langage MATeL, un DSML (Domain-Specific Modeling Language)qui permet de décrire des scénarios de test spécifiques aux applications mobiles. Sa syntaxe abstraite, i.e un métamodèle et des contraintes OCL, permet au concepteur de manipuler les "variables métier" du test d'applications mobiles: spécifications du testeur et du mobile ou encore résultats attendus et résultats obtenus. Il permet également d'enrichir ces scénarios avec des "points de variabilité", qui autorisent de spécifier des variations dans le test en fonction des particularités d'un mobile ou d'un ensemble de mobiles. La syntaxe concrète de MATeL, inspirée de celle des diagrammes de séquence UML, ainsi que son environnement basé sur Eclipse, facilitent considérablement la conception des scénarios.
Pour vérifier et valider notre proposition, nous avons construit une plateforme de test en ligne originale, permettant d'exécuter les scénarios sur plusieurs modèles de téléphones. Notre démarche est illustrée et prouvée au travers de nombreuses expériences.
M. Youssef RIDENE est ingénieur à la Sté Neomades. Son travail est soutenu par l'ANRT et par le Conseil Régional d'Aquitaine.
Information et inscription
Isabelle Erreçarret : i.errecarret@estia.fr Tél : +33.5.59.43.84.14